Job Description

Courtyard by Marriott Edinburgh

£13.50 per hour plus service charge. 40 hours per week over 5 days.

Fixed term contract until 30th April 2027

We are seeking a dedicated and enthusiastic individual to join our team.

As a Food and Beverage Supervisor, you'll be at the heart of our guest experience, delivering exceptional service and ensuring our guests have a memorable dining experience.

Are you passionate about hospitality and customer service? Do you take pride in providing top-notch service with a smile? If so, we'd love to hear from you.

Key Responsibilities

  • Oversee the Food and Beverage team as they carry out their duties
  • Assist in the preparation and serving of food and beverages to guests in an efficient and pleasant manner.
  • Maintain cleanliness and organisation of the dining areas, ensuring compliance with health and safety standards.
  • Provide excellent customer service by addressing guest inquiries and resolving complaints promptly and professionally.
  • Support the Food and Beverage team in all operational duties, including setting up and clearing tables, restocking supplies, and assisting with inventory management.
  • Assist in the coordination and execution of events and special functions.
  • Ensure all areas are well-stocked and presented impeccably at all times.
  • Desired Skills and Experience
  • Previous experience in a similar role within the hospitality industry is desirable but not mandatory.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Ability to work in a fast-paced environment and handle multiple tasks efficiently.
  • Strong attention to detail and a commitment to delivering high standards.
  • Flexible to work various shifts, including evenings, weekends, and holidays.

How to prepare for a job interview at Valor Hospitality

Show Off Your Customer Service Skills

In the hospitality-food-service sector, it's all about the customer experience. Be ready to discuss specific examples where you've gone above and beyond for a customer or handled a difficult situation. They’ll appreciate knowing that you can keep your cool and maintain a positive attitude even when things get a bit hectic!

Know Your Menu Inside and Out

Whether you're applying for a temporary role as a server or in the kitchen, it’s important to familiarise yourself with the menu and any signature dishes they serve at Valor Hospitality. During the interview, they might ask about your food and drink recommendations, so having a few tasty suggestions up your sleeve will show you're genuinely interested in contributing to the team.

Emphasise Your Flexibility

Temporary roles often require a bit of juggling with shifts and responsibilities. Be sure to convey your willingness to adapt and take on different roles as needed. Share instances where you’ve quickly switched tasks or taken the initiative to help out your colleagues, showing that you're a team player.

Dress the Part and Exude Personality

In hospitality, first impressions matter! Even for a temporary position, donning smart-casual attire can set the right tone. Plus, don't hold back on your personality – let your enthusiasm shine through, as they’re looking for someone who can mesh well with the team and create a welcoming atmosphere for guests.
